Have you ever thought of choosing MRI technologist as a career? If so, then you’ll want to find out how to become one, what is the salary and what area they work in. Let’s quickly talk about those.

How To Become An MRI Technologist – Most techs take courses to earn an associate’s degree. The field of study is radiology or another related field. After that, they continue their education for another couple of years, studying towards getting an MRI tech certification in Antioch CA prior to applying for positions as a Certified MRI Tech in Antioch CA. Most of the time, it could take from 1 to 2 years in becoming allowed to serve as an MRI technologist.

MRI Tech Salary in Antioch CA

Earning – One top benefit about having a career as an MRI technologist is the compensation. You will find the opportunity to make good money. Having said that, the typical salary for any MRI tech is about $70,000 annually. Be aware that what a technologist will receive depends on various factors. This includes what lab they work in, the area they are employed in and the experience they have. The good news is that they are very popular and the earning potential is good.

Where Do They Work – MRI technologists in Antioch CA function in various settings, for example health centers, labs, and doctor’s offices. Additionally, they are hired at diagnostic imaging centers, and also mobile radiology units. These are simply a few instances of where they work. Also, they are hired many cities, towns, and regions across the country. Most of the time, they are qualified to work in other countries as well. If you become an MRI tech, then you will possess a talent that is in high demand, which permits you to widen the likelihood of receiving a job.

The Perks of Learning through MRI Programs

Lots of New Technology

How many people do you know that can operate an MRI? The answer is probably zero, or one at the most. Those who love technology will have a wonderful time operating MRIs. You’ll have to study radiation physics and learn to deal with this complex piece of equipment.

Lots of Biology

MRIs are the most accurate methods we have for assessing tissues and organs. They’re better than CTs and tremendously better than x-rays. If you’re interested in biology, you’ll have a blast seeing all the different organs in their different states. Patients will present with many diseases, so you’ll see what abnormal organs look like.

Helping People

It’s an MRI tech’s job to explain the procedure to every patient that comes in. For these patients, you’re the person helping them and calming them down. If they have any questions, they’ll direct them to you. You will also help position them properly to obtain the best images.

The more you interact with patients, the more social skills you acquire. You’ll only see most patients once in your life, but you have to establish a connection with them and find a way to ease their anxiety. This should help you out immensely in life.

Clean Work Environment

Hospitals can get hectic, but not your workspace. Patients will enter your workspace in order. Your area will almost always be neat and clean. You will rarely experience bodily fluids like vomit, which is important for many people.

Less Physical Effort

Healthcare is composed of many groups. MRI techs exert the least physical effort compared to most of them. You’ll spend a lot of time on your feet, but you have your own workspace, and you won’t have to leave it except rarely.

Your shifts will also be planned ahead. MRIs are usually scheduled days or weeks in advance. You won’t have to work too many nights and spend much time away from your family. The job is also less stressful compared to other healthcare careers.
